arm64-docker-builder - internal notes

(just in case you run into some similar issues)

Step 1: running install-arm64-devtools.sh

Problem 1: qemu crashed on install-arm64-devtools.sh

This only happens because I had too few memory on the host machine. A good working setting is 1 GByte for the Ubuntu host machine and 512 MByte for the QEMU machine.

RESUMEE

OK, let's skip all these and just ignore it. Just check, if our dependent packages are installed:

$ dpkg -l | grep btrfs-tools
ii  btrfs-tools                      3.17-1.1                     arm64        Checksumming Copy on Write Filesystem utilities
$ dpkg -l | grep libsqlite3-dev
ii  libsqlite3-dev:arm64             3.8.7.4-1                    arm64        SQLite 3 development files
$ dpkg -l | grep libdevmapper-dev
ii  libdevmapper-dev:arm64           2:1.02.90-2ubuntu1           arm64        Linux Kernel Device Mapper header files

OK, everything is GREEN. Go ahead and compile Docker.
